Tutorial
Video game concept
Includes an in-game tutorial to familiarize the player with controls and any game specific functionality.

Help screens or overlayed cue sheets that simply list the controls can also be considered as some minimalistic tutorials, but should be noted in the comments on their limited scope.
This can also be part of the actual game or separate training mode which likely has more intimate guiding on how things work.
